Skip to content
Write review For Business
  • Login

Contact Mestizo Restaurant and Tequila Bar Customer Service

Mestizo Restaurant and Tequila Bar Phone Numbers and Emails

Customer Service:

  • +44 207 387 4064
    London
  • +44 203 327 6122
    London (Chelsea)
  • +3 491 816 8257
    Madrid, Spain
  • +44 207 388 1333
    Store and Online Market

Mestizo Restaurant and Tequila Bar Emails:

Customer Service
London, London (Chelsea), Madrid, Spain, Store and Online Market
Send Message
Is this your business?
PissedConsumer Club

Contact Information

Mestizo Restaurant and Tequila Bar Website:

Mestizo Restaurant and Tequila Bar Help Center:

Corporate Office Address:

Mestizo
103 Hampstead Road
London, England NW1 3EL
United Kingdom

Ask a First Question About Mestizo Restaurant and Tequila Bar

0 symbols (min 100)

Compare Mestizo Restaurant and Tequila Bar Customer Service To

Companies are selected automatically by the algorithm. A company's rating is calculated using a mathematical algorithm that evaluates the information in your profile. The algorithm parameters are: user's rating, number of resolved issues, number of company's responses etc. The algorithm is subject to change in future.

Write a review
Do you have something to say about Mestizo Restaurant and Tequila Bar? What happened? What can we help you with?
Submit review Don't show this popup